ABSTRACT
Scheduling is a key activity of project monitoring and control. While network scheduling techniques like CPM and PERT are very useful in monitoring projects these techniques have limitations in use for road and bridge construction, high-rise building construction, pipeline laying etc where same set of activities are repeated many times.
